deCarta Adds LBS Industry Executive Steve Altman to Team

May 24, 2013 By Editor

Former Nokia/NAVTEQ Executive joins as VP Business Development

May 23, 2013, San Jose, CA: deCarta, Inc., the leading independent LBS technology company announced today that Steve Altman has joined the company as Vice President, Business Development. Mr. Altman was previously VP Consumer Business North America with Nokia L&C (formerly NAVTEQ). He will focus on new strategic business opportunities for deCarta from major customers looking for a truly independent and scalable LBS technology platform to provide customized maps, geocoding, local search and navigation.

Mr. Altman brings along tremendous experience within the technology industry including senior positions as VP Consumer North America at Nokia; Wireless Devices and Accessories VP/GM at Samsung; VP Sales at Sony Ericsson; and Device Management Software as VP Americas at Innopath.

deCarta provides the full spectrum of geospatial technology including geocoding, custom mapping, local search, routing and navigation and has been an LBS technology enabler to the many of the largest LBS apps and services for the past 10 years including Google Maps (2004-2008). Given its ability to process map and POI content from all major suppliers around the world, the company is seeing increased demand from major mobile and internet service providers who want the ability to create their own differentiated LBS offerings with the flexibility to utilize content best suited to their business – including the ability to index and control their own custom content.

About deCarta

deCarta is the leading independent, global LBS technology company. It provides specialized geospatial technologies for online mapping, routing, navigation, geocoding, local search and geo-data integration and processing. The company’s platform is used by leading high volume LBS applications and services in the mobile, internet, enterprise-fleet and automotive markets where scalability, flexibility and reliability are vital. deCarta’s customers and technology partners include Samsung, Inrix, T-Mobile, Appello, Ford, General Motors OnStar, Cybit, Wireless Matrix, MapIT, eMapgo, Nokia, Telstra/Sensis, TomTom, WHERE/eBay. deCarta is privately held and headquartered in San Jose, California with international offices in Germany, and China. www.decarta.com.
